# Meda

> Meda (Polygonatum verticillatum (L.) All. / Polygonatum cirrhifolium (Wall.) Royle) is a plant used in Ayurveda, from the Liliaceae (Asparagaceae) family. Not listed in WHO monographs; classified as endangered/critically endangered in IUCN Red List categories across its Himalayan range; included in Indian medicinal plant conservation priority lists.

## How does it work?

- Hypoglycemic activity through enhancement of insulin secretion and improvement of [glucose](/glossary/compounds-d-g/#glucose) uptake by peripheral tissues, mediated by saponin fraction
- Anti-inflammatory and [analgesic](/reference/analgesic/) mechanisms involving inhibition of lipoxygenase pathway and reduction of pro-inflammatory mediators
- Bronchodilatory action through tracheorelaxant effect on bronchial smooth muscle, with [antispasmodic](/glossary/pharmacology/#antispasmodic) properties mediated by calcium channel modulation

## Which traditional uses are supported by research?

- Antimalarial and [antipyretic](/reference/antipyretic/) properties validated through in vivo studies using Plasmodium models and fever-inducing paradigms
- [Diuretic](/reference/diuretic/) activity confirmed through experimental models, supporting traditional use in urinary disorders and as a body purifier
- Antibacterial and antifungal activity validated against multiple pathogenic organisms, confirming traditional use in infection management

## Dosage forms and preparation

**Dosage Forms:** Churna (powder), Kwatha (decoction), Capsules, Tablets, [Ghrita](/herb/ghrita/) (medicated ghee), Avaleha (confection), Lehya

**Standard Dosage:** 3-6 g tuber powder per day; 50-100 mL decoction twice daily; 500-1000 mg extract capsules daily

**Bioavailability:** Steroidal saponins show moderate oral bioavailability (15-25%). Sapogenins released by intestinal hydrolysis are better absorbed than glycosylated forms. Mucilaginous [polysaccharides](/glossary/compounds-o-q/#polysaccharides) are not absorbed but provide prebiotic and gut-protective effects. Ghrita-based preparations enhance sapogenin bioavailability by 40-60%.

**Optimal Timing:** With meals or with milk for [Rasayana](/reference/rasayana/) and nutritive effects; morning for tonic action; with Ghrita for reproductive health

**Standardized Extract:** Tuber extract (8:1 hydroalcoholic) standardized to minimum 5% total steroidal saponins (as diosgenin equivalents). [Mucilage](/glossary/compounds-l-o/#mucilage)-rich aqueous extract for GI applications. Ghrita preparation per classical Ashtavarga Ghrita formula.

**Shelf Life:** Fresh tubers: 7-10 days refrigerated. Dried powder: 18 months. Extract capsules: 24 months. Ghrita: 24 months.

**Storage:** Fresh tubers at 5-10 deg C. Dried material below 25 deg C in airtight containers with desiccant due to hygroscopic mucilage. Ghrita in glass containers at room temperature. Protect from light and excessive heat.

**Marker Compounds:** Diosgenin, Polygonatum saponins, Convallarin, Convallamarin, Polysaccharides (fructans), Beta-sitosterol, [Stigmasterol](/reference/stigmasterol/)
